Gérard Courbouleix–Dénériaz, also known as Razzia, is a French graphic artist born in Montparnasse in 1950. Razzia is one of the last poster artists to remain in an era dominated by computer-generated images. He began his career in what can be called the golden age of poster art.

From Photography to Poster Art. Razzia was born in Montparnasse in 1950. Always interested in art, he started his career as a photographer, following the greatest names in the music world of that time. His images were popular among the fans of Rolling Stones, Led Zeppelin and Pink Floyd.
